This unit describes the purpose and benefits of creating lesson plans. Lesson plans help teachers plan effectively and consistently. They also serve as a record for future reference or in the case of classroom observation. Lesson plans no matter how simple or detailed, should include learning objectives for students and the timing and procedure of lesson activities and instruction. To help teachers be the most prepared, the number of students and the materials needed should be included in the lesson plan. For inexperienced teachers, a lesson plan allows one to practice teaching and following a structure. This creates a structured and predictable environment for students who will be looking to the teacher to lead them. I have learned that lessons are an aid for both teachers and students because they help teachers think deeply about the material, thereby ensuring a more enjoyable learning experience for students.
